Output 2c17f1732fb04d83cc2da354b41f36101c3b73b203c5f322fead26d3ed9bc25e:2

value
21030436
script pubkey
OP_0 OP_PUSHBYTES_20 6abdd1f17330525af5de3fef5d515069e4a4292b
address
bc1qd27arutnxpf94aw78lh4652sd8j2g2ft42euy8
transaction
2c17f1732fb04d83cc2da354b41f36101c3b73b203c5f322fead26d3ed9bc25e
spent
true